HB5136 amends the Fish and Aquatic Life Code to revise fishing license fees and requirements for Illinois residents. It mandates that holders of lifetime fishing or hunting licenses or lifetime sportsmen's combination licenses purchased on or after January 1, 2027, must pay the corresponding resident or non-resident fee when purchasing any permits or stamps required under the Code or the Wildlife Code. The bill also reduces fees for 3-year fishing licenses for residents aged 65 or older and resident veterans of the United States Armed Forces.
